Tooth Decay (Cavities)Tooth decay, also known as cavities, is one of the most common dental issues among children. It happens when bacteria in the mouth break down sugars from food and drinks, producing acids that eat away at the tooth enamel. This leads to small holes in the teeth, which can cause pain and infection if not treated. Causes of Dental Issues:

Importance of Regular Dental VisitsRegular visits to pediatric dentistry in Aurora play a vital role in preventing dental issues. Dentists can spot early signs of problems, provide professional cleanings, and offer tips on kids dental care. They also help educate both parents and children on good oral hygiene practices, which are key to maintaining a healthy smile.
